Hydroxyethyl Methyl Cellulose (HEMC), also known as MHEC or Methyl Hydroxyethyl Cellulose, is a water-soluble nonionic cellulose ether. It is available in the form of a free-flowing powder or granules.
HEMC/MHEC is a versatile product that serves multiple purposes. It can be used as a high-efficiency water retention agent, stabilizer, adhesive, and film-forming agent in various applications.
In the construction industry, HEMC/MHEC is widely used in tile adhesives, cement, and gypsum-based plasters. Its water retention properties make it an excellent choice for enhancing the workability and durability of these materials.
Furthermore, HEMC/MHEC finds applications in liquid detergents and many other industries where its adhesive and film-forming properties are highly beneficial.
